  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from New York John F Kennedy Airport to Rhodes?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Rhodes with an airline and back to New York John F Kennedy Airport with another airline. Booking your flights between New York John F Kennedy Airport and RHO can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from New York John F Kennedy Airport to Rhodes?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to Rhodes from New York John F Kennedy Airport up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
